Blood Sugar Impact of Old El Paso, Chicken Enchiladas
This food has a high impact on blood sugar and may cause a rapid spike. Consider pairing with protein or fat to moderate the impact.
Key Nutrients
Per 283.0g serving| Nutrient |
Amount per serving |
|---|---|
| Carbs | 35.0g |
| Sugars | 3.0g |
| Fiber | 4.0g |
| Protein | 17.0g |
| Fat | 12.0g |

INGREDIENTS:
ANCHO CHILI SAUCE (WATER, TOMATO PUREE, ANCHO PEPPER, MODIFIED CORN STARCH, SPICE, SUGAR, SEA SALT, SOYBEAN OIL, CITRIC ACID, ONION POWDER, AUTOLYZED YEAST EXTRACT, GARLIC POWDER, HYDROLYZED CORN PROTEIN, XANTHAN GUM, NATURAL FLAVOR, AUTOLYZED YEAST), CORN TORTILLA (WATER, LIMED CORN FLOUR, CELLULOSE GUM), COOKED WHITE CHICKEN MEAT (CHICKEN, WATER, MODIFIED CORN STARCH, ISOLATED SOY, PROTEIN, SALT, SODIUM PHOSPHATE), REDUCED SODIUM COLBY CHEESE (MILK, CHEESE CULTURES, SALT, ENZYMES, ANNATTO EXTRACT), REDUCED SODIUM MONTEREY JACK CHEESE (MILK, CHEESE CULTURES, SALT, ENZYMES), ONIONS.

Old El Paso, Chicken Enchiladas is a food product in the frozen dinners & entrees category with a Blood Sugar Impact score of 61.0.
Old El Paso, Chicken Enchiladas has a Blood Sugar Impact (BSI) score of 61.0. Lower scores indicate less impact on blood glucose levels.
Old El Paso, Chicken Enchiladas contains 12.4g carbs, 1.1g sugars, 1.4g fiber, and 6.0g protein per 100g.
